  1. Document Scrutiny: The Foundation of Clarity

Unveiling the Challenge: Missing Links in Documentation

At the heart of every court securitization audit lies a meticulous examination of documents. The challenge often lies in the missing links – incomplete or elusive documents that create gaps in the securitization trail. Legal professionals and forensic auditors kick off the audit by scrutinizing mortgage agreements, transfer records, and other pertinent documents to reconstruct a clear and unbroken chain of ownership.

Navigating the Landscape: Document Reconstruction Strategies

Navigating this challenge involves strategic document reconstruction. This entails leveraging legal avenues to request missing documents, collaborating with industry experts to fill informational gaps, and employing forensic techniques to piece together the puzzle. The goal is to establish a comprehensive and reconstructed trail that serves as the foundation for the audit’s findings.

  1. Forensic Analysis: Unraveling Financial Intricacies

Cracking the Code: Analyzing Complex Financial Structures

A critical component of a comprehensive court securitization audit is the forensic analysis of complex financial structures. Forensic auditors dive into the intricate world of mortgage-backed securities, tranches, and collateralized debt obligations, employing sophisticated techniques to unravel financial intricacies and expose potential irregularities.

Precision in Practice: Forensic Accuracy

The precision of forensic analysis is paramount. Forensic auditors must meticulously interpret financial data, identify patterns, and unveil irregularities without overlooking critical details. This precision ensures the accuracy of financial reconstructions, providing a solid foundation for the audit’s findings.
